UFC on ESPN 39 main card #1 in cable Saturday

July 13, 2022 by Jason Cruz Leave a Comment

UFC on ESPN 39 which took place on Saturday on ESPN drew 762,000 viewers and 316,000 in the A18-49 demo per Nielsen via ShowBuzz Daily.  The prelims on ESPN drew 548,000 viewers and 223,000 viewers in the A18-49 demo. 

The telecast was number 1 on cable this past Saturday.  The prelims landed at number 5 overall.  

The main card which aired at 9:00pm ET featured Rafael Fiziev as he stopped Rafael dos Anjos in the 5th round of their fight.  

The main card drew 0.24 in the A18-49 demo, 0.11 in F18-49, 0.37 M18-49, 0.16 A18-34, 0.07 F12-34, 0.20 M12-34, 0.29 A25-54 and 0.35 in the over 50 category. 

The prelims drew 0;17 in the A18-49 demo, 0.09 in the F18-49, 0.26 in the M18-49, 0.11 A18-34, 0.04 F12-34, 0.19 A25-54, 0.26 in the over 50.
